WebbIt is safe and easy to use isopropyl alcohol that is 70% or higher to wipe down hard surfaces in your vehicle. That includes steering wheel, dash, armrests, console, seat adjusters, shifter, cup-holders, doors, handles, and more. Alcohol is also suitable for cleaning the imitation leather used in some vehicles. WebbYou may have a large variety of car care products, but isopropyl alcohol is not commonly one of them. Rubbing alcohol (also known as isopropyl alcohol) can be used to help achieve a streak-free finish on your glass surfaces. You can mix a small amount (around 10% of the total volume) into the cleaning solutions above, or you can use a mixture of rubbing alcohol and water as a final step in your cleaning process.

Webb19 aug. 2024 · Rubbing alcohol is a cleaning solution that can be used to remove non-polar compounds from surfaces. That is why when you want to remove wax, sealant, or grease from your car’s paint or coat, rubbing alcohol is always a good choice.
